引言
C语言作为一种基础且强大的编程语言,在计算机科学领域有着广泛的应用。进行C语言实验不仅能够加深对语言特性的理解,还能培养编程思维和解决问题的能力。本文将深入解析C语言实验指导书中的答案,并提供一些实战技巧,帮助读者更好地掌握C语言。
一、C语言实验指导书答案深度解析
1. 数据类型与变量
在C语言中,数据类型是定义变量所使用的数据种类。常见的有整型(int)、浮点型(float)、字符型(char)等。了解每种数据类型的特点和适用场景是进行实验的基础。
示例代码:
#include <stdio.h>
int main() {
int num = 10;
float fnum = 3.14;
char ch = 'A';
printf("整型变量: %d\n", num);
printf("浮点型变量: %f\n", fnum);
printf("字符型变量: %c\n", ch);
return 0;
}
2. 控制结构
C语言中的控制结构包括条件语句(if-else)、循环语句(for、while、do-while)等,它们用于控制程序的执行流程。
示例代码:
#include <stdio.h>
int main() {
int i;
for (i = 1; i <= 5; i++) {
if (i % 2 == 0) {
printf("偶数: %d\n", i);
} else {
printf("奇数: %d\n", i);
}
}
return 0;
}
3. 函数
函数是C语言的核心组成部分,它允许我们将代码模块化,提高代码的可重用性和可维护性。
示例代码:
#include <stdio.h>
void printMessage() {
printf("Hello, World!\n");
}
int main() {
printMessage();
return 0;
}
二、实战技巧
1. 编程规范
编写规范、易读的代码是提高编程效率的关键。遵循命名规范、注释规范和代码格式规范,有助于他人理解和维护你的代码。
2. 代码调试
熟练掌握调试工具和技巧,如使用printf语句打印变量值、设置断点等,可以帮助你快速定位和解决问题。
3. 模块化设计
将程序分解为多个模块,每个模块负责特定的功能,有助于提高代码的可读性和可维护性。
4. 学习资源
利用网络资源,如在线教程、博客、论坛等,可以扩展你的知识面,提高编程技能。
总结
通过深入解析C语言实验指导书答案和掌握实战技巧,可以帮助你更好地理解和应用C语言。不断实践和总结,相信你会成为一名优秀的C语言程序员。
